Target protein-directed adsorption of graphene oxide (GO) as an electroactive indicator was employed for electrochemical detection of thrombin. The method was highly sensitive and the detection limit was as low as 9.7 pg ml(-1).
Gold-platinum nanowires are proposed as electrocatalysts for a real-time nonenzymatic impedancimetric detection of glucose. The electrochemical behavior of the obtained platform toward electrocatalytic oxidation of glucose, including a proposal for the detection mechanism, is shown.
